Analyze your site's internal link structure and generate an optimized hub-and-spoke linking plan. Finds orphan pages (no internal links pointing to them), identifies link equity bottlenecks, and creates specific linking instructions to maximize SEO impact.

keyword-cluster-architect first to define your topic structure."Example 1: "Audit my blog's internal links" → Discover pages, map structure, find orphan pages, generate specific linking instructions with anchor text and placement.
Example 2: "I just published a new article, what should I link to it?" → Identify 3-5 existing pages that should link to the new article, with specific anchor text and paragraph locations.
Example 3: "Optimize internal links based on my keyword clusters" (after keyword-cluster-architect) → Use cluster structure to define ideal hub-spoke links. Compare current vs ideal. Generate gap-filling instructions.
Inspect URL → Request IndexingAfter 4 weeks: check Google Search Console for the orphan pages. Did impressions/clicks increase? After 8 weeks: did rankings improve for target keywords? Internal linking compounds — each optimization makes the next one more powerful.
